Helicopter Twirls Out of Control into Palm Groves at Frequented Southern California Shoreline

A helicopter flying above a crowded southern California shoreline suddenly started spinning uncontrollably, finally dropping height and crashing into a row of palm groves as beachgoers observed.

Recordings uploaded on social media depict the chopper starting to spin near Huntington Beach then plunging in the direction of the border of the beach, where it gets stuck between palm groves and a staircase adjacent to the shoreline route.

Emergency Response Details

Local firefighters reported five persons were rushed to the hospital including a pair who were in the helicopter and were “rescued from the debris” subsequent to the crash on that day.

Three individuals on the street were hurt. Specifics on their injuries were not yet released.

The reason for the accident was not yet disclosed.

Planned Function

The department said the chopper was associated with an yearly “Cars and Copters” benefit occasion planned for the following day.
